Para 1.20 In May 2024, the centre held a Mosquito
event, the highlight of which was hosting
Colin Bell, a former RAF Mosquito pilot!
The event was very well attended by
visitors from all over the country and raised
several hundred pounds through donation
and sales.
Restoration of the Cold War cabin has
progresses with it being made watertight
and decorated internally. There are
currently plans to try and restore some sort
of electrical power to the cabin as the next
stage.
In September 2024 there was a Tornado
Event, which was attended by over 150
visitors and featured talks on the history of
the aircraft and operating it in various
conflicts. This event also saw various
donations of Tornado memorabilia gifted to
the centre.
The Centre was also donated a trail
Highball bouncing bomb some time ago, a
display stand was made enabling it to go
on display!
Elsewhere several hundred more articles
were catalogues and added into the
archive.

Para 1.51 The Marham Aviation Heritage Centre
(AHC) is run by a team consisting of 20+
members. All are either current of former
members of the Royal Air Force or have
some association with RAF Marham.
Members are recruited from RAF Marham
and the wider service community. Most
members have a passion for RAF history
The charity’s organisational
structure and any wider
network with which the
charity works
Para 1.51 The charity works closely with Heritage
Centres at other RAF Bases to develop
mutually beneficial relationships, and to
assist others where necessary.
Relationship with any
related parties
Para 1.51 The AHC works closely with RAF Marham
in order to ensure that anything of historical
importance, wherever possible, is saved,
catalogued and either archived or
displayed, to ensure a long-lasting legacy
for future generations to enjoy.
